The article provides the analysis of the impact of monetary policy shock generated by the Bank of Russia on the Russian stock market yield dynamics. We have estimated the features and duration of the effect using SVAR models and monthly data for the period from 2005 to 2013. We examine a wide range of proxies for the monetary conditions: the key interest rate, monetary aggregate M2, the refinancing rate and the interbank lending rate.
One of the main goals of higher professional education is to provide national communities with highly qualified human resource. In turn, the global challenge of transition to a knowledge-based society influences the national systems of professional training and predetermines a substantial increase in the role of innovations and scientific research in the countries' economic and social progress. Therefore, it is essentially important that the system of professional education be aimed at developing students' research competence in higher educational settings. As shown, the Russian students are mainly aware of the necessity of research work as a part of the educational curriculum and its importance. On the other hand, most of them do not have much interest in their own research projects. The paper discusses the problem of students' motivation for research activity from the psychological-acmeological point of view. This approach seems to be beneficial since it takes into account the idea of sustainable development and lifelong learning. The study presented was aimed at evaluating the effect of the training programme on students' motivation for research activity which was implemented into the educational process. The results of the programme implementation have shown a significant change in students' motives for doing research among undergraduate students whose majors were natural sciences, mathematics and electrical engineering. Key words: higher professional education, personal and professional development, research activity, research-based teaching, students' motivation.
